Demand for doughnut holes on Saturdays at Don's Doughnut Shoppe is shown in the following table. Demand (dozens) 19 20 21 22 23 24 Relative Frequency .03 .07 .16 .01 .11 .16 Demand (dozens) 25 26 27 28 29 Relative Frequency .10 .13 .09 .04 .10 Click here for the Excel Data File a-1. Determine the optimal number of doughnut holes, in dozens, to stock if labor, materials, and overhead are estimated to be $5.00 per dozen, doughnut holes are sold for $6.60 per dozen, and leftover doughnut holes at the end of each day are sold the next day at half price. (Round your answer to the nearest whole number.) Optimal number of doughnuts
a-2. What is the resulting service level? (Round your answer to 2 decimal places.) Service level
